Indonesia is not just adopting external influences; it is cultivating its own cultural wave, often termed the "Indosphere." The government is pushing for a shift from a consumer to a producer of digital IP, with a focus on animation and gaming. This push includes a joint Indonesia-China research and development center for video and animation, which aims to create globally appealing content by combining Chinese technology with Indonesia's rich cultural diversity. Indonesia's digital media revolution is not just about consuming content but creating and sharing it. A massive 44% of Indonesians regularly follow news creators and social media influencers. The creator economy has produced superstars like , known for his comedic videos on TikTok where he has over 70 million followers, and Raffi Ahmad , who, along with his wife Nagita Slavina, commands a staggering 76.7 million followers on Instagram. This digital engagement is also profoundly reshaping how the nation interacts with its heritage. In 2025, museum visits surged by 400%, partly driven by social media campaigns that invite people to create creative content about cultural heritage, bridging the gap between tradition and modern digital habits.

In the global arena, Indonesia has broken through via digital platforms and international labels like 88rising. Jakarta-born rapper Rich Brian and singer-songwriter NIKI have achieved global stardom, performing at major Western festivals like Coachella and charting on the US Billboard. Their success has proven that Indonesian-born artists can seamlessly navigate the global music market.
